Can NMN Help With Tiredness? The Evidence-Led Answer
NMN may support biological pathways involved in cellular energy production. Small human studies have also reported selected improvements in walking, daytime function, and tiredness-related measures. However, research hasn’t established NMN as a reliable treatment for ordinary fatigue, chronic tiredness, sleep disorders, or medically unexplained exhaustion. (PubMed)
The most accurate answer sits between dismissal and hype. NMN clearly shows biological activity in several human trials because NAD-related blood markers often rise. Yet a measurable biochemical change doesn’t guarantee that you will feel more awake, motivated, or physically capable. Your starting health and fatigue cause remain crucial.

Tiredness, Fatigue or Sleepiness: What Are You Feeling?
Tiredness often follows insufficient rest or a demanding day. Fatigue usually feels deeper and may limit normal activity. Sleepiness means you struggle to remain awake. These sensations overlap, but they aren’t interchangeable. Therefore, research measuring drowsiness may not answer every question about persistent fatigue, weakness, or reduced motivation.
Finding the cause matters more than choosing the label. Poor sleep, stress, anaemia, diabetes, thyroid disorders, infections, sleep apnoea, depression, pain, and some medicines can cause fatigue. The NHS tiredness guidance recommends medical advice when unexplained tiredness continues or disrupts daily life.

How NMN and NAD+ Connect to Cellular Energy
At cellular level, nicotinamide mononucleotide acts as a precursor used to make NAD+ (nicotinamide adenine dinucleotide). Cells rely on NAD+ during numerous chemical reactions. These include pathways that process nutrients and help produce ATP, the transferable energy source used throughout the body.
Mitochondria help generate ATP from available nutrients. NAD+ supports redox reactions involved in this process. Researchers also examine mitochondrial function and oxidative damage / oxidative stress within ageing biology. However, this plausible mechanism doesn’t prove that an oral NMN supplement will remove tiredness or restore lost stamina.

What Human Research Says About NMN for Fatigue
Human NMN trials remain relatively small and short. Researchers have assessed blood NAD+, mobility, insulin sensitivity, fatigue questionnaires, and sleep quality. Several trials show biological effects. However, their doses, participant ages, methods, and outcomes vary considerably, making universal conclusions about NMN for fatigue difficult.
The wider evidence remains restrained. A 2024 systematic review found non-significant overall improvements in physical strength and aerobic outcomes. A later meta-analysis found no meaningful NMN benefit for several muscle and mobility measures in older populations. These findings don’t prove NMN never helps, but they weaken sweeping performance claims.

The 12-Week Japanese Study—What It Really Found
This randomised double-blind placebo-controlled study enrolled 108 independently mobile Japanese adults aged 65 or above. Researchers divided them into morning NMN, afternoon NMN, morning placebo, and afternoon placebo groups. Participants took 250 mg daily for 12 weeks, allowing researchers to examine time-dependent intake.

The afternoon NMN group produced the largest effect sizes for chair-rise performance and subjective sleepiness. However, afternoon placebo participants also reported improved sleepiness. The results therefore suggest a possible signal for lower limb function and drowsiness, rather than decisive evidence of better overall physical performance.
Research Case Study: How the Japanese Trial Measured Change
The researchers used the Pittsburgh Sleep Quality Index and Jikaku-sho shirabe questionnaire for subjective outcomes. They measured chair-rise ability through 5-times sit-to-stand (5-STS). These recognised tools add structure, although most sleep and fatigue outcomes still depended on participants recalling and reporting their experiences.
Did Afternoon NMN Work Better Than Morning NMN?
The trial compared post meridiem (afternoon intake) with ante meridiem (morning intake). Selected afternoon findings appeared stronger. NAD biology also interacts with the circadian rhythm. Nevertheless, one small study cannot establish afternoon NMN as a universal timing rule for every age, routine, or health condition.

“NMN intake in the afternoon effectively improved lower limb function and reduced drowsiness in older adults.” — Kim et al., 2022.
The quotation reflects the authors’ conclusion, not a universal clinical rule. Mitsubishi Corporation Life Sciences funded the research, supplied the tablets, and covered publication costs. Industry support doesn’t automatically invalidate a trial, but transparent disclosure and independent replication improve confidence in the findings.

NMN Isn’t Caffeine—and It Shouldn’t Feel Like It
Caffeine can increase alertness comparatively quickly because it affects adenosine signalling in the nervous system. NMN enters a different metabolic pathway. It shouldn’t be presented as an immediate stimulant. A quiet improvement in daytime function may still matter, but it feels very different from a sudden caffeine-driven lift.

How Long Might NMN Take—and How Can You Assess It Fairly?
There’s no clinically proven countdown for NMN and energy. Relevant human trials usually measured outcomes after several weeks rather than several hours. Two older-adult studies used 250 mg daily for 12 weeks. Their designs don’t prove that every user needs 12 weeks or will notice any benefit.
Memory can also play tricks. A simple diary provides firmer ground. Record your sleep duration, morning energy, afternoon sleepiness, exercise, caffeine, illness, and medicine changes. Review weekly patterns rather than one unusually good day. MedlinePlus fatigue guidance also suggests tracking energy patterns.

A Regulatory Note for UK and US Readers
Regulatory status can change. In Great Britain, the FSA register currently lists a β-NMN novel-food application as undergoing risk assessment. In the US, the FDA lists a 2025 new dietary ingredient notification for NMN. A submitted application or notification isn’t the same as general approval or endorsement.
